The Nottinghamshire Football Association is seeking to appoint an Independent Chair to lead the Board of Directors. 

 

The role is to facilitate board meetings with the existing team of directors, both independent and nominated, in supporting the Senior Management Team with directing the business affairs of the organisation. 


It is anticipated that the person appointed will have a passionate interest in football but will also have experience in the following key areas:


a) Ensuring the organisation operates in accordance with the Companies Act (2006) and other relevant legislation.
b) Setting and approving objectives to deliver the strategic business plan and regularly review performance against those objectives.
c) Monitoring the financial affairs of the Association.
d) Overseeing the management of risk to the Association, including matters of Health & Safety.
e) Maintaining an effective corporate governance structure.
f) Reviewing and amending regulations for the better administration of the Association.
g) Ensuring a duty of care to all employees by providing oversight as required
h) Adopting code of conducts for the Board and County Members.
i) Ensuring the County FA operates within the Articles of Association. 
j) Reviewing and approving any policy changes recommended by the Executive to ensure ongoing governance of the association within FA rules and regulations. 
k) Adhering to the Safeguarding Operating Standards and undertaking any appropriate training requirements as determined by The Football Association.


The initial term of the appointment will be for three years in accordance with the Articles of Association; Board meetings are convened every 4-6 weeks during the evenings, either in person at the County FA Offices in Chilwell, or online with Microsoft Teams, and usually commence at 6.30pm.
